Put the latest edition of today’s most trusted drug reference guide in your nursing students’ hands with DELMAR NURSE’S DRUG HANDBOOK 2012 EDITION. This essential resource clearly describes the most important information for over 770 of the latest and most common FDA-approved drugs. Each entry provides a wealth of information concerning drug action, pharmacokinetics, dosage, interactions, and contraindications. Clear guidelines are also provided for administration of drugs, communication with clients, and nursing considerations. This edition offers even more convenience with an iPhone/iPod touch Application that places the complete drug guide at your fingertips with enhanced search options. Jones and Bartlett Learning 2013 Nurse’s Drug Handbook is the most up-to-date, practical, and easy-to-use nursing drug reference. Updated annually, it provides: * Accurate, timely facts on hundreds of drugs from abatacept to zonisamide * Concise, consistently formatted drug entries organized alphabetically * No-nonsense writing style that speaks your language in terms you use everyday * Index of all generic, trade, and alternate drug names * Chemical and therapeutic classes, FDA pregnancy risk category, and controlled substance schedule * Indications and dosages, as well as route, onset, peak, and duration information * Incompatibilities and contraindications * Interactions with drugs, food, and activities * Adverse reactions * Nursing considerations, including key patient-teaching points * Mechanism-of-action illustrations * Warnings and precautions New drug entries include: * azilsartan medoxomil * belatacept * clobazam * deferiprone * ezogabine * Factor XIII * fidaxomicin * icatibant * linagliptin * roflumilast * ticagrelor * vilazodone
